Output c7d31bb731246ba31bc6995efad1eabc3d6f42fced119362200c56c21ba767fe:0

value
999995008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de22cf9b692f55516c0501d0e16154957dd6e949 OP_EQUAL
address
3MwZdqaX9Nvz1vudTFc2WzbMPBryyCPNDS
transaction
c7d31bb731246ba31bc6995efad1eabc3d6f42fced119362200c56c21ba767fe
confirmations
331439
spent
true